On 04/27/2018 05:52 AM, Arvind Yadav wrote:
> Replace the manual validity checks for the GPIO with the
> gpio_is_valid().

I haven't looked through the code paths very closely, but I
think that get_named_gpio() might return -EPROBE_DEFER, which
would be something we want to pass to the caller.

So rather than returning -ENODEV and hiding the reason the
call to of_get_named_gpio() failed, you should continue
returning the errno it supplies (if not a valid gpio number).
